The New York Giants have mostly failed in all three phases of a football game in 2025, and on Tuesday the team hoped to correct part of their problems: the kicking game.

The Giants released kicker Younghoe Koo after a tumultuous season with the Big Blue. Koo, a former Pro Bowler, missed two field goals in the team’s 29-21 loss to the Washington Commanders. He made 4 of 6 field goal attempts in five games with the Giants.

Koo also suffered an inexplicable viral moment against the New England Patriots three weeks ago when his foot got caught in the turf. The result was a failed attempt and a turnover for the Giants in the midst of a crushing loss.

“I was getting close to the ball and, in the cold weather, the ball slid off the bottom and moved,” Koo said, via the New York Post. “I couldn’t kick the ball. The ball was moving when I was going towards him, so I just stopped.

Missteps and missed field goals have been a big part of the Giants’ 2025 season.

New York ranks 12th in yards gained and 22nd in points scored. Their defense ranks 29th in points allowed and 30th in yards allowed. The team has used three kickers, including Koo, Graham Gano and Jude McAtamney. Jamie Gillan and Cameron Johnston have been used in the punting game.

The Giants are 2-12 this season with three games left. If they finish with the same number of wins, it would be the fifth time since they won the Super Bowl in 2011 that they have finished with four or fewer wins. New York has only made the playoffs twice in that span.
